Wayne House Killed in Gyrocopter Crash in Mississippi

HERNANDO, MISSISSIPPI (December 2, 2017) – Wayne House has been identified as one of the two men killed in a gyrocopter crash in DeSoto County on Saturday, according to a local news source. (map)

The crash happened on Saturday evening just after 6:00 pm. An experimental gyrocopter type aircraft with two people on board took off from the Eagles Ridge airport, and crashed for an unknown reason a short time later in a heavily wooded area.

The two people on board, 70 year old Wayne House and 43 year old Richard House were both tragically killed as a result of the accident. The gyrocopter was mostly destroyed in the crash, but the NTSB and the FAA are both on site to investigate. HWG Law is still receiving updates on this accident at this time.
